Facts about Someone See

When was Someone See released?


Someone See is first released on October 10, 2000 as part of Dogwood's album "Building A Better Me" which includes 16 tracks in total. This song is the 9th track on this album.

Which genre is Someone See?


Someone See falls under the genre Rock.
